Jamiat Ulema-e-Islam-Fazl (JUI-F) supremo Maulana Fazlur Rehman claimed that the “former army chief Gen (rtd) Qamar Javed Bajwa toppled the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f’s (PTI) government.” Talking to media, Rehman said, “Someone should stand up to the establishment and say it is doing wrong”. “The protest will continue until things are settled, as the establishment has nothing to do with politics. As a result of this protest, there will be a revolution,” Rehman maintained.
